What is 1 milliliter the same as?

What is 1 milliliter the same as?

1 milliliter (ml) is also 1 cubic centimeter (cc) In other words 1 milliliter is exactly the same as a little cube that is 1 cm on each side (1 cubic centimeter).

What does 1 ml ML mean?

A Metric unit of volume. Equal to 1/1,000 (one-thousandth) of a liter. Used for small amounts of liquid. The abbreviation is ml or mL. It takes about 20 drops (from a standard eye dropper) to make one mL.

What is an example of 1 ml?

Everyday Examples of Metric

Measurement Example
1 mL The volume of a large drop of water
5 mL The volume of a teaspoon
15 mL The volume of a tablespoon
30 mL One fluid ounce, a standard shot

What is a 1 meter?

1 m is equivalent to 1.0936 yards, or 39.370 inches. Since 1983, the metre has been officially defined as the length of the path travelled by light in a vacuum during a time interval of 1/299,792,458 of a second.

What metric unit is equal to 1 milliliter?

Definition: Millilitre The millilitre (ml or mL, also spelled milliliter) is a metric unit of volume that is equal to one thousandth of a litre. It is a non-SI unit accepted for use with the International Systems of Units (SI). It is exactly equivalent to 1 cubic centimetre (cm³, or, non-standard, cc).
